Ireland salvaged hopes of reaching the Euro finals – but left it late as substitute Shane Long equalised in the 90th minute against the Group D leaders.

Shane Long snatched a point for Ireland in the last minute

Poland now lead Germany and Scotland by a point but Long's effort kept them in the hunt a further two points behind.

Ireland were first to threaten when Wes Hoolahan took advantage of a quickly taken free-kick to surge towards Lukasz Fabianski’s goal, but scuffed his shot wide.

But with Grzegorz Krychowiak prompting the Poles they started to dominate and went ahead with their first effort on target after 26 minutes. Robbie Brady dallied on the ball and Slawomir Peszko pounced to dispossess him, surge past Marc Wilson and smash an unstoppable left-foot shot across Shay Given and inside the far post.

Brady was unlucky  when his deflected 52nd-minute cross looped over Fabianski and came back off the inside of the post.

But Martin O'Neill brought on Long seven minutes from time and he proved the saviour as he forced the ball home in the last minute after Hoolahan had headed on a corner.
